Elijah McClain: 1 Officer Convicted, 1 Acquitted Over Death of Colo. Black Man
A Colorado police officer has been convicted of criminally negligent homicide and assault over thedeath of Elijah McClain. Randy Roedema — who was fired from his job in 2020 — was found guilty of the crimes at a court in Aurora, Colo on Thursday, reported multiple outlets includingTheNew York Times,Associated PressandLos Angeles Times. A second officer, Jason Rosenblatt, was acquitted of all charges, according to the reports. The trial of Roedema and Rosenblatt — whowere indictedin connection with the 2019 death in July 2022 — was the first of three trials for five people charged in connection with McClain’s death....
